I just had the FM 50 SUV installed today at Tuffy. They cut off the old, added about 12" of pipe, and welded in the new. Charged me $90. It sounds pretty good, I haven't had it up to highway speeds yet, but at 40mph cruising through town, you can't hear it much in the cabin, which is probably a good thing. It's about 80% of my expectations, I thought/hoped it would be a tad louder.
